1.11信息编程
文章编号: 1383 | 评级: 未分级 | 最新更新: Fri, Dec 1, 2017 4:03 PM
信息编程在一个独立的程序段中。当程序执行到所在的行时,信息显示在屏幕上方的信息显示区域,并且一直有效。一个新的信息显示,上一条信息上滚。在MSG信息显示指令中还可加入表达式、变量等,在显示时将这些表达式、变量的当前值显示出来(类似高级语言的print语句)。
举例:
MSG (“THIS IS A SAMPLE=”, 25*4)
显示结果为:“THIS IS A SAMPLE=100”
在这一基础上,信息编程能实现三种模式的报警号:信息(I)、警告(W)、错误(E)。
编程时要求第一个引号中信息编号首字母为大写的“I/W/E”那么系统就会自动判别并在显示结果中加上方括号,其中:
“I”表示当前正在进行的系统操作
“W”可用于提示操作者使用不规范,若不予相关改进,系统也能照常运行
“E”表示由编程错误、设置参数错误、操作错误等引起的错误报警,出现这个报警时系统会进入错误状态,在解决问题后需要按复位键解除报警才能继续执行操作。
为了避免与系统报警冲突,建议在首字母后跟数字来共同组成信息编号。
举例:
MSG (“I7142”,“工作台移动”)
显示结果为:[I7142] 工作台移动
MSG (“W12620”,“请关闭防护门”)
显示结果为:[W12620] 请关闭防护门
MSG (“E34701”,“错误使用开关”)
显示结果为:[E34701] 错误使用开关